Working Principles

MT46V128M4TG-5B:D TR operates based on the principles of dynamic random-access memory. It stores data in capacitors within each memory cell, which are periodically refreshed to maintain the stored information. When data needs to be accessed or written, the appropriate row and column addresses are provided, allowing the memory controller to read or write the data from/to the specific memory location.
